Instructional Designer (100% Remote) Req #1940 Virtual Since our founding in 2011, our mission has been to improve the lives of seniors and their caregivers. We are deeply passionate about communication and committed to becoming the foremost provider of services and solutions that enable seniors to lead more meaningful and independent lives. We also understand the power of connection and the profound impact it has on the lives of individuals who are hard-of-hearing. By utilizing enhanced automatic speech recognition, human captioning, and innovative product development, we deliver easy-to-use, cutting-edge technology to our primarily senior customer base. Our near real-time phone captioning technology allows individuals with hearing loss to see what callers are saying, enabling them to regain their connection to the world. ClearCaptions is a Federal Communications Commission (FCC)-certified telephone captioning provider, adhering to the highest industry standards of privacy, security, and professionalism. Position Summary: The Instructional Designer will develop and manage training initiatives and project plans from inception to results. This role is ideal for a motivated self-starter, who works well under pressure and is flexible to changing priorities. This is a Remote/Work from Home position reporting to the Director of Learning & Development. What you will do: Plan, design, and develop highly effective training programs. Create technical and procedural eLearning for corporate and department specific training programs. Create eLearning and training products for required training, soft skills, employee development, manager development, etc. Collaborate with subject matter experts to develop instructor-led training, eLearning, or experiential learning. Develop training content using a variety of instructional techniques and formats such as role playing, simulations, scenarios, games, team exercises, group discussions, videos, etc. Create training products such as user guides, participant/trainer guides, job aids, handouts, etc. Research, organize and create content in logical eLearning sequences for maximum learner retention. Regularly maintain and update course content based on quality reviews and feedback from trainers, learners, forms, surveys, and ClearCaptions management. Proofread and edit own work and work of others to improve quality, readability, consistency, formatting, and effectiveness of training products. Create custom graphics and animations as needed to elevate the learning experience. Collaborate with management and stakeholders to ensure timely and accurate deliverables. Test, debug, and troubleshoot training products and courses. Assist in managing the Learning Management System (LMS). Assist with various training related tasks such as training coordination, research, reporting, L&D team support tasks, etc.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ree in Instructional Design, Instructional Technology, or related field of study. 5+ years of experience as an Instructional Designer and/or eLearning Developer. Must have proved experience with Articulate. Must have proven experience creating technical and procedural training programs. Experience facilitating live training sessions, ideally in a remote environment, preferred. Knowledge of instructional design theory, adult learning theory, and design thinking. Experience working with Vyond, Camtasia and Adobe Creative Suite isa plus. Experience managing a Learning Management Systems is a plus. Strong interpersonal skills, ability to work independently and collaboratively with colleagues and staff to create a high-quality results-driven, team-oriented environment. Ability to focus on details, adhere to quality standards and adapt to changing business needs. Excellent verbal and written communication skills, presentation, and problem-solving skills. Self-starter with strong organizational and time management skills, self-directed and able to handle multiple priorities with demanding timeframes. Demonstrated ability to use discretion, make sound decisions, and maintain confidentiality. Willingness and ability to work flexible hours within all US time zones. Proficient in MS Office, modern communication tools for virtual teams (i.e., MS Teams). Physical Demands: Employees may experience the following physical demands for extended periods of time: Sitting, standing, and walking (95-100%) Keyboarding (70-90%) Viewing computer monitor, tablet and cell phone requiring close vision (70-100%) Work Environment: 100% Remote: Work environment is at home. Compensation: $80,000 to $90,000 determined by competitive market analysis and internal equity considerations.
